Subject: Quickstore 4.2 — bloom filter now fronts the KV layer

Plugin authors: starting with this release, Quickstore places a bloom filter ahead of the key-value store. Negative lookups return faster; false positives fall through safely. No API changes are required on your side. Verify your plugin against the staging build referenced below.

session token of fahif-tadup = htk3_9c7

**Alert: Reconciliation Variance Exceeded.** The nightly Stockglass reconciliation job detected a variance above the configured threshold between warehouse counts and ledger totals. This usually indicates a partial batch commit or a skipped delta file rather than genuine shrinkage. Please verify the batch manifest before approving any correcting entries. The triage runbook and variance history are on the page below.

dashboard of yahaf-kajep = https://jira.zemvarsys.internal/display/projects/browse/browse/a08b

**Action item PM-7 (owner: platform team, due next sprint):** During the Thornbury outage, the Quillfeather API exhausted its database connection pool and began queuing requests until auth timeouts fired, which the on-call initially read as a credential compromise. We will cap pool growth, add jitter to reconnect attempts, and emit a distinct metric so saturation is never mistaken for an auth failure. No credentials were exposed; pool handles are scoped per-service. The revised pooler will ship with the following tuning constants.

tuning table, kajog-bawip:
TIERS = {
    "kelius": 256,
    "lammir": 543,
}